Once I saw God,
Standing behind a tree. He wanted to play hide and seek; Wanted me to count as he ran to hide. But I didn’t. One time He was swimming Inside my cup of pineapple sake, At a sushi restaurant. I lifted Him to my lips, But He disappeared. I swear I saw Him playing guitar, At a concert in L.A. He broke into a solo, But ran away Before I could get his autograph. There was only one time That I could smell His scent, Feel His warmth And touch His soul to mine – When I held you.
